Trick Definitions and Ideas
To understand the distinctions in between Surety Contract bonds and insurance, it's important to realize essential meanings and ideas.
Surety Contract bonds are a three-party agreement where the guaranty assures the Performance of a legal commitment by the principal to the obligee. The principal is the celebration that gets the bond, the obligee is the celebration that calls for the bond, and the guaranty is the event that ensures the Performance.
Insurance policy, on the other hand, is a two-party arrangement where the insurer agrees to make up the insured for specific losses or damages for the repayment of premiums.
Unlike insurance, Surety Contract bonds do not provide monetary protection to the principal. Rather, they offer guarantee to the obligee that the principal will certainly accomplish their contractual responsibilities.
Types of Protection Offered
Now let's check out the different sorts of coverage used in Surety Contract bonds and insurance coverage.
When it involves surety Contract bonds, there are two main types of coverage to consider:
- ** Performance Bonds **: These bonds give economic protection to the task proprietor in case the service provider falls short to finish the project as set. If the contractor defaults or falls short to fulfill the terms of the Contract, the Performance bond makes certain that the task owner is compensated for any financial losses sustained.
- ** Repayment Bonds **: Settlement bonds are developed to safeguard subcontractors and providers. They guarantee that the service provider will certainly pay all costs and costs connected to the project, making sure that subcontractors and suppliers aren't left unpaid.
On the other hand, insurance coverage commonly uses protection in the form of policies for various risks, such as building damage, obligation, or personal injury. Insurance policies supply financial defense in case of unanticipated mishaps or losses.
